Transaction d845323d69a54151c313bb8673386ecaf868bb5b921bf44105f14313650040ea
1 Input
1 Output
-
d845323d69a54151c313bb8673386ecaf868bb5b921bf44105f14313650040ea:0
- value
- 4448378
- script pubkey
- OP_0 OP_PUSHBYTES_20 361d684d90889126e97d1ef301581215b09683c4
- address
- bc1qxcwksnvs3zgjd6tarmeszkqjzkcfdq7ytxh4c5